Chief Digital Officer Africa 2019

Chief Digital Officer provides an engaging space for digital transformation leaders to gather, it draws on case studies from differing industries that identify change in technology, processes and employee engagement.

Chief Digital Officer Africa 2019: Bringing together digital transformation leaders, their teams and a diverse cross-section of software and service providers, business strategy pioneers and technology implementers.

Chief Digital Officer Africa 2019 is a peer-led conference not only for digital and IT professionals, but also their colleagues who are caught up in melee of digitisation. Leadership and effective change management is central to the role of the Chief Digital Officer, but not every organisation has one in place. The question is, without a Chief Digital Officer, who in the organisation is going to drive digital change?

Not only showcasing digital innovation from diverse industry sectors, Chief Digital Officer Africa delivers high-level interactive discussions on the latest technology trends, building agile across the business and effective leadership techniques to drive change. Including international keynote presentations, C-level panels, private lunches and collaborative discussion groups, delegates will be given the opportunity to discuss common concerns, celebrate successes and gain clarity on the digitisation/digitalisation/digital transformation challenge.

What is new to the 2019 edition of Chief Digital Officer 2019?

Chief Digital Officer Africa 2019 takes a practical look at digital transformation from a leadership and organisational perspective. Providing an engaging space for digital transformation leaders to gather, Chief Digital Officer Africa will draw on case studies from differing industries that identify change in technology, processes and employee engagement.

The conference is focused on change management, leadership and the evolving business in the digital world. The content and discussions are high-level and strategic while looking at how culture should permeate the business. At its core, the conference will examine the convergence of people, processes and technology. A highlight in 2019 is how different industries are approaching digital transformation, and look to draw on the similarities. This will be specifically addressed during the Heavy Digital Focus Day.
